Good news! The Zero draft of the #pandemic instrument(@WHO)recognizes the relevance of the Right to Science for the effective management of global health emergencies. In2022 we called on the #INB(WHO) to include a reference to this human right. They did it.@TAGTeam_Tweets@ScFrDy
Although much more work needs to be done towards the full recognition of the Right to Science as a game-changer against pandemics, the mention of this right is a meaningful achievement. For the first time, a draft instrument negotiated within the @WHO refers to the RightToScience
